Description
If you're looking for a substantial road cycling adventure that truly earns its views, the Bridge into Golden – View from Chatfield Dam loop from 60th & Sheridan - Arvada Gold Strike delivers. This moderate 58.9-mile (94.8 km) road cycling route packs in 2103 feet (641 metres) of elevation gain over roughly 4 hours and 59 minutes, offering a diverse journey for riders with good fitness who are ready for a long day in the saddle.
What to expect on Bridge into Golden – View from Chatfield Dam loop from 60th & Sheridan - Arvada Gold Strike
The route unfolds as a dynamic tour, starting with improved bike lanes and wider sidewalks in Arvada, connecting to extensive paved trails and urban greenways. You'll enjoy diverse scenery, from vistas of the Front Range and Rocky Mountains to the rolling foothills and expansive Chatfield Reservoir within Chatfield State Park. Be prepared for varied terrain; while much of the loop is well-paved, a one-mile section across the Chatfield Dam features sharp gravel, and parts of the Chatfield Internal Trail also involve dirt and gravel. This makes a road bike with wider tires or a hybrid/gravel bike a more comfortable choice, especially if you want to avoid punctures.
Planning your visit
This loop is a significant undertaking, requiring nearly five hours of riding, so plan your day accordingly. The starting point at 60th & Sheridan in Arvada is well-connected, including to the RTD Gold Strike G-Line Station, making public transport an option. Arvada is known for its extensive network of bike-friendly infrastructure, so you'll find good access here. Given the length and potential for unpaved sections, ensure your bike is in good condition and carry plenty of water and supplies.
